The Demon's Lullaby: The Whisper of Immortal Boundlessness
The sky was a canvas of twilight hues, and the cobblestone streets of the ancient city of Eternia echoed with the distant laughter of children. Yet, for Liana, a young girl with eyes like the night sky and hair the color of moonlight, the laughter was but a distant echo. She wandered the shadowed alleys, her mind consumed by the haunting melody that seemed to weave through the fabric of her dreams.
Liana had always known that she was different. Her parents, the renowned demon hunter siblings, had disappeared under mysterious circumstances when she was but a baby. She grew up among humans, yet she never fit in. She was too fast, too strong, and her dreams were always filled with the eerie whispers of an immortal lullaby.
One night, as the moon hung heavy in the sky, Liana stumbled upon an ancient book hidden within the ruins of the old library. The pages were covered in arcane symbols and cryptic warnings, but it was the final page that captivated her—the page that depicted a demon with eyes like stars, cradling a child in its arms, singing a lullaby.
The melody resonated within her, a familiar tune that made her heart ache with a sense of loss and longing. She felt a strange connection to the image, as if she was the child in the demon's arms. Driven by a mysterious pull, Liana embarked on a quest to uncover the truth behind the lullaby and her parents' disappearance.
Her journey led her to the enigmatic city of the Immortals, a place where the boundaries between life and death were as fluid as the shifting sands. There, she met Kael, a powerful immortal with a secret of his own. Kael had been tasked with protecting the secret of the Immortals, a secret that could either grant immortality or spell the end of the world.
As they ventured deeper into the realm of the Immortals, Liana and Kael uncovered a plot by the Demon King to use the lullaby to bind the souls of the Immortals to his will. The melody, once a gift of eternal life, had become a curse, capable of destroying all that was sacred and beautiful in the world.
The Demon King's army was an imposing force, made up of demons and corrupted immortals who were willing to sacrifice everything for the promise of eternal power. Liana and Kael knew that they had to act swiftly. They delved into the forbidden libraries of the Immortals, seeking the means to counteract the demon's curse.
The path was fraught with peril. Liana's connection to the lullaby grew stronger, and so did her powers. Yet, the true challenge lay within herself. She had to confront the shadows of her past and the fears that had shaped her destiny. As she did, she discovered that her parents' disappearance was not an accident, but a deliberate act of protection, a sacrifice to keep her safe from the Demon King's clutches.
The climactic battle took place in the heart of the Immortals' palace, where the demon's lullaby reached its crescendo. Liana, wielding the ancient power of her parents, confronted the Demon King in a fierce duel. The air was thick with the scent of sulfur and the sound of clashing swords. In the end, it was not Liana's physical prowess that won the day, but her heart, which was filled with the love of her parents and the courage to face the truth.
With the lullaby shattered and the Demon King's power weakened, Liana and Kael returned to Eternia, a world now free from the shadow of immortality. Liana was no longer a child of mystery and fear, but a guardian of the realm, her eyes still filled with the stars that had once haunted her dreams.
As the world began to heal, Liana found solace in the arms of Kael, a love that transcended the bounds of time and space. Together, they vowed to protect the balance between life and death, ensuring that the world would always be safe from the whispers of the immortal boundlessness.
